Challenges in AI Implementation

Many organizations face significant hurdles when attempting to scale AI beyond initial proof-of-concept projects. A primary issue is the lack of AI-ready data; fragmented and siloed data systems can severely hinder model accuracy and insights. Additionally, there is often a misalignment between business strategy and technology deployment, where companies prioritize tools over actual business outcomes. Organizational resistance also plays a role, as successful AI transformations require a shift in processes and workforce dynamics. This execution divide highlights the importance of a holistic approach to AI integration that considers both technological and human factors.
The New Enterprise AI Playbook
To effectively harness AI, organizations should adopt a structured transformation framework. The first stage involves discovery and proof of value, where specific business outcomes are defined, and high-impact use cases are identified. The next stage focuses on integration and orchestration, where AI models are embedded into core workflows, supported by robust data governance. Following this, companies should optimize and scale their AI capabilities, transitioning from isolated models to a connected ecosystem that enhances cross-functional intelligence. Ultimately, mature organizations will reach a point of autonomous operations, where AI systems proactively manage resources and drive strategic decisions.
Measuring AI ROI: Key Dimensions
For organizations to validate their AI investments, measuring ROI is essential. Successful companies evaluate AI through three primary dimensions: direct ROI, which includes operational cost reductions and efficiency gains; indirect ROI, focusing on enhanced customer lifetime value and satisfaction; and strategic ROI, which encompasses shorter product cycles and faster innovation. Companies that leverage structured AI development services ensure that their AI initiatives align with measurable business objectives, linking performance metrics directly to revenue growth and operational efficiency. This structured approach is crucial for demonstrating the tangible value of AI investments.
